發泡市場趨勢

建設產業的需求不斷成長

  • 發泡不含揮發性有機化合物,不會消耗臭氧層,全球暖化潛勢值較低,且消費量的能源很少,因此在環境上可接受並用於建築和施工。它有助於創建更均勻的組件,從而實現更好、更緊密的絕緣、更高的能源效率和有限的能源消耗。
  • 發泡用作建築隔熱材料的成分,例如管道、屋頂隔熱材料、門、覆材和需要基礎的結構。它也用作門窗密封劑。
  • 它們主要用於聚氨酯泡棉,經常用於管道中,以防止熱量損失,在寒冷地區保持溫度,並在遠距加熱時防止凍結和破裂。
  • 它們也用於酚醛發泡,但其應用受到限制。酚醛發泡主要用於充當屋頂、牆體空腔和地板隔熱隔熱材料隔熱層的面板。由於全球建設活動的增加,發泡市場預計將顯著擴大。
  • 亞太地區在建築領域佔據主導地位,其中印度、中國和其他東南亞國家顯著推動了市場成長。
  • 上述積極因素預計將在整個預測期內推動市場成長。

中國主導亞太市場

  • 中國作為第一組成員,預計到 2024 年將氫氟碳化合物的生產和使用凍結在商定的基準水平,到 2029 年產量將分階段控制在凍結水平以下 10%。我們計劃逐步減少其使用。
  • 儘管CFC-11因其對臭氧層破壞的影響而於2010年在國際上被禁止使用,但已發現證據證明CFC-11作為硬質聚氨酯泡棉保溫材料領域的發泡存在非法生產和使用。英國非政府組織環境研究機構進行的實地研究發現,中國空氣中CFC-11的濃度明顯高於預期,證明CFC-11是有害的。
  • 除了禁用的CFC和HCFC(其使用受到監管併計劃到2040年逐步淘汰)外,中國正在開發替代發泡,例如預混CP(環戊烷)、HFO混合物和水的使用。
  • 中國擁有全世界最大的建築業。然而,隨著中國政府旨在向服務主導經濟轉型,該產業的成長速度變得越來越慢。
  • 中國擁有世界第二大包裝產業,由於客製化包裝的興起,對微波食品、休閒食品、冷凍食品等需求的增加,預計在預測期內將持續成長。
  • 中國擁有世界上最大的紡織服裝業,是該國經濟的重要參與者。然而,由於與美國的貿易戰和市場的成熟,該國在美國服裝出口市場的佔有率有所下降。
  • 因此,上述因素可能會影響預測期內中國發泡的需求。

Blowing Agents Market Trends

Increasing Demand from the Building and Construction Industry

  • Owing to their non-VOC, non-ozone depleting, low global warming potential, and reduced energy consumption, blowing agents are environmentally acceptable, and are thus, used in building and construction. They help to create better uniform components, resulting in better, tighter insulation, higher energy efficiency, and limited energy consumption.
  • Blowing agents are used as a component in building insulation, such as block pipe and roof insulation, doors, sheathing, and in structures that require foundation. They are also used as sealants for windows and doors.
  • They are majorly used in polyurethane foams that have high utilization in pipes to prevent loss of heat and to maintain temperatures even during cold climates, to avoid freezing or cracking for long-distance heating.
  • They are also used in phenolic foams, but with limited usage. Phenolic foams are majorly used in panels to act as insulating barriers in roofing, wall cavities, and floor insulation. The increasing construction activities worldwide is expected to significantly boost the blowing agents market.
  • The Asia-Pacific region dominates the building and construction sector, with India, China, and various other South East Asian countries driving the market growth significantly.
  • The positive factors like the aforementioned ones are expected to drive the market growth through the forecast period.

China to Dominate the Asia-Pacific Market

  • As a Group I member, China is expected to freeze HFC production and use at agreed baseline levels, by or before 2024, and is expected to phase down the production and use, beginning with a 10% phasedown below freeze levels, by 2029.
  • Though the usage of CFC-11 was banned internationally in 2010, owing to the ozone depletion effects of the substance, evidence has been found proving the illegal production and usage of CFC-11 as a blowing agent in the rigid polyurethane foam insulation sector. According to a field study carried out by the Environmental Investigative Agency, a UK-based NGO, the atmospheric levels of CFC-11 in China are significantly greater than expected, proving the harmful nature of CFC-11.
  • Apart from the banned CFCs and HCFCs (whose usage is regulated and is expected to phase out by 2040), China has been using alternative blowing agents, like preblended CP (cyclopentane), HFO blends, and water.
  • China has the world's largest construction industry. However, the growth rate of the industry has become increasingly modest, as the Chinese government is looking to shift toward a services-led economy.
  • China has the second-largest packaging industry in the world and is expected to witness a consistent growth during the forecast period, owing to the rise of customized packaging, increased demand for microwave food, snack foods, and frozen foods, among others.
  • China has the world's largest textile and apparel industry, which is also a key player for the country's economy. However, there has been a drop in the market share occupied by the country in the global apparel export market, owing to the trade war with the United States and maturation of the market.
  • Hence, the aforementioned factors are likely to affect the demand for blowing agents in China during the forecast period.
